Writing a good essay introduction is crucial to the overall success of your essay. The introduction serves as the first impression that your reader will have of your work, and as such, it is important to make it as effective as possible. In this essay, we will explore some strategies that you can use to write a compelling and engaging introduction for your next essay.

First, it is important to understand the purpose of the essay introduction. The introduction should provide context for your reader, giving them an understanding of what the essay is about and why it is important. It should also set the tone for the rest of the essay and provide an overview of the main points that you will be discussing.

One effective strategy for writing a good essay introduction is to start with a hook. A hook is a sentence or phrase that grabs the reader's attention and encourages them to keep reading. This could be a provocative question, a surprising statistic, or a compelling anecdote. The goal of the hook is to engage the reader and pique their curiosity, so that they want to read on to learn more.

Another important element of a good essay introduction is the thesis statement. The thesis statement is a single sentence that summarizes the main argument or point of your essay. It should be clear and concise, and it should provide the reader with a roadmap for the rest of the essay. The thesis statement should be placed near the end of the introduction, after the hook and any necessary background information.

In addition to a hook and a thesis statement, it is also important to provide some background information in your essay introduction. This will give your reader the context they need to understand the rest of the essay. However, be careful not to provide too much information – the introduction should be brief and to the point, and the majority of the details should be saved for the body of the essay.

Finally, be sure to end your introduction with a transition that leads smoothly into the body of the essay. This could be a transitional phrase or sentence that connects the introduction to the first paragraph of the essay.

In conclusion, writing a good essay introduction requires a combination of a strong hook, a clear thesis statement, relevant background information, and a smooth transition. By following these strategies, you can create an introduction that will engage your reader and set the stage for a successful essay.

An essay introduction is a crucial part of any written piece as it sets the tone for the reader and provides a clear overview of what the essay will cover. A good essay introduction should be engaging, informative, and should provide a clear indication of the direction the essay will take.

Here are some tips on how to write a good essay introduction:

  1. Start with an attention-grabbing opening: This could be a quote, a statistic, a question, or an anecdote that captures the reader's attention and sets the stage for the essay.

  2. Provide some background information: This helps to provide context and helps the reader understand the purpose of the essay.

  3. Clearly state the thesis: The thesis is the main argument of the essay and should be clearly stated in the introduction.

  4. Provide an outline of the essay: This helps the reader understand the structure of the essay and what to expect in the coming paragraphs.

  5. Avoid using too much jargon or technical language: It's important to make the essay accessible to a wide audience, so try to use language that is clear and easy to understand.

Overall, a good essay introduction should be engaging, informative, and should provide a clear indication of the direction the essay will take. By following these tips, you can craft an introduction that will effectively set the stage for the rest of your essay.
